Moving On Up @ ITT Corporation


ITT website Today ITT Corporation announces Daniel J. Hucko has joined ITT Space Systems Division as director of communications. He will be responsible for leading all public relations, marketing communications, employee communications, corporate philanthropy and community relations activities for the division.  ITT’s Space Systems Division, headquartered in Rochester, New York, provides innovative remote sensing and navigation solutions to customers in the Department of Defense, intelligence, space science and commercial aerospace to help them visualize and understand critical events happening on Earth, in the air, or in space in time to take effective action.

Prior to joining ITT, Hucko served as senior vice president, corporate communications and investor relations at Harris Interactive Inc., a leading online market research company based in Rochester, New York. While at Harris, he also managed The Harris Poll, one of the world’s best-known and longest-running public opinion polls.

“As we continue to expand our space business, Dan’s expertise and experience will prove to be an incredibly valued asset,” said Chris Young, president of ITT Space Systems Division. “We are excited to have him on our team.”

Hucko also worked for 11 years at Young & Rubicam advertising agency. He held progressively senior management positions advancing to senior vice president and managing director of the Rochester, New York office. Prior to working at Young & Rubicam, Hucko founded Stanton and Hucko — an integrated communications company that was purchased in 1989 by Young & Rubicam.
